Carnation Chiropody Felt with Skin-friendly Adhesive

 

You can rely on this medical-grade padding to provide cushioning and protection for sensitive areas of your feet. The felt material offers gentle support whilst the adhesive backing ensures secure placement on your skin without causing irritation or discomfort during removal.

This product is designed for use in podiatry practices and home foot care routines. The breathable felt construction allows air circulation whilst maintaining its protective properties throughout extended wear periods.

 

How the Felt Padding Works

 

The chiropody felt creates a barrier between your skin and footwear, redistributing pressure away from problem areas. The adhesive backing bonds securely to clean, dry skin whilst remaining gentle enough for sensitive areas commonly treated in foot care.

You can cut the felt to your required size and shape, making it suitable for various foot conditions that require customised padding solutions. The material maintains its cushioning properties even when subjected to the pressures of walking and standing.

How to Apply Chiropody Felt Padding

Clean and thoroughly dry the area of skin where you plan to apply the padding. Cut the felt to your required size and shape using clean scissors, ensuring the edges are smooth to prevent skin irritation. Remove the backing paper from the adhesive side and position the felt carefully on the target area, pressing firmly to ensure complete contact with your skin.

Duration of Use and Removal

You can wear the padding for several days, depending on your individual needs and skin tolerance. Remove the felt gently by lifting one edge and peeling slowly to minimise discomfort. If you experience any skin irritation or the adhesive begins to lift, remove the padding immediately and allow your skin to rest before reapplying if necessary.
